The Definitive Guide to what is md5 technology
The Definitive Guide to what is md5 technology
Blog Article
On thirty December 2008, a group of scientists announced at the twenty fifth Chaos Communication Congress how they'd utilised MD5 collisions to make an intermediate certification authority certificate that gave the impression to be authentic when checked by its MD5 hash.[24] The researchers utilised a PS3 cluster within the EPFL in Lausanne, Switzerland[38] to change a standard SSL certification issued by RapidSSL into a working CA certification for that issuer, which could then be utilized to build other certificates that would appear being legit and issued by RapidSSL. Verisign, the issuers of RapidSSL certificates, reported they stopped issuing new certificates using MD5 as their checksum algorithm for RapidSSL after the vulnerability was introduced.
The key reason why for That is that this modulo Procedure can only give us ten different effects, and with ten random quantities, there is nothing halting a number of those effects from becoming a similar amount.
The MD5 hash algorithm authenticates messages by making a exceptional identifier or “electronic fingerprint” for the file. It then verifies this exclusive fingerprint if the concept is obtained. This fingerprint is also called a hash worth or checksum.
You will discover modern hashing algorithms which have better security properties than MD5. They build more elaborate hashes and possess various levels of stability. Here are some of the most common possibilities to MD5 hash:
Small adjustments into the input give radically diverse hash values – A small transform within the input improvements the resulting hash worth so drastically that there now not seems to be a correlation amongst the two.
A hash collision occurs when two different inputs create the same hash value, or output. The security and encryption of a hash algorithm depend on producing exclusive hash values, and collisions depict protection vulnerabilities which can be exploited.
It opened alternatives and launched ideas in data integrity checks, electronic signatures, and password protection that shaped A lot of our existing cybersecurity techniques.
The SHA-2 and SHA-three household of cryptographic hash features are secure and encouraged alternate options for the MD5 message-digest algorithm. They're much a lot more resistant to probable collisions and make really one of a kind hash values.
Suppose we have been provided a message of one thousand bits. Now we need to add padding bits to the initial message. In this article We'll add 472 padding bits to the initial message.
A calendar year afterwards, in 2006, an algorithm was posted that used tunneling to find a collision inside a person moment on a single notebook computer.
Pursuing from the footsteps of MD2 and MD4, MD5 makes a 128-little bit hash price. Its major goal is always to confirm that a file continues to be unaltered.
The uniqueness and one particular-way character of MD5 Algorithm make it website a successful Device in cryptography, ensuring details stays confidential and unaltered through transmission. But as you'll see afterwards In this particular weblog, it's not without having its share of strengths and weaknesses. Stay tuned!
Embedded programs and minimal-resource environments. In some very low-source environments, exactly where the computational ability is restricted, MD5 is still made use of on account of its fairly speedy processing pace and low source requirements.
This algorithm was formulated by Ronald Rivest in 1991, and it is often used in electronic signatures, checksums, along with other security purposes.